Output 65888d203c90a768f733b3aa0462d63839dc61cc8a108632ce4513e333215d8e:38

value
416437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d80a3561862d3abc09e777efe37d555474c9cfe OP_EQUAL
address
38kp4Eyx61x1vzVS7EySp6mcTjuHdb5PsW
transaction
65888d203c90a768f733b3aa0462d63839dc61cc8a108632ce4513e333215d8e
spent
true